rtl8180 + PLD
Łukasz Maśko
masko w ipipan.waw.pl
Pon, 15 Lis 2004, 22:06:30 CET
Dnia poniedziałek, 15 listopada 2004 21:47, MarcinR napisał:
[...]
> 1. Pakiet kernel-net-rtl8180-2.6.8-4.athlon.rpm z ac na ftp PLD
> Wrzuca mi moduł rtl8180_24x.ko.gz, który, nawet sądząc po nazwie, nie
> powinien działać. Wyskakuje błąd nieprawidłowego formatu modułu. Po
> rozpakowaniu gunzip-em do rtl8180_24x.ko w ogóle nie widzi takiego
> modułu.
O tym zapomnij, jest jeszcze siłą rozpędu ale do niczego się nie nadaje.
> 2. Ndiswrapper (emulator sterowników windowsowych pod linuksa).
> Zainstalowałem z paczki rpm (z ftp PLD, ale nie dla athlona, bo takiej
> nie ma, tylko dla i686, ale to nie powinno robić różnicy).
> Program się instaluje, uruchamia normalnie, pozwala załadować sterowniki
> windowsowe, pokazuje później dostępne urządzenia (jedno, Hardware
> Presence). Problem pojawia się przy próbie załadowania modułu
> ndiswrapper (modprobe ndiswrapper). Okazuje się, że nie ma takiego
> modułu. I faktycznie, w /lib/.. itd. nie ma ndiswrapper.
Zainstalowałeś sam pakiet ndiswrapper? To za mało, potrzebujesz jeszcze
kernel-net-ndiswrapper. A ponieważ wersja 0.9 nie kompiluje się na obecnym
kernelu, to nie trafiła na FTP. Jeśli wiesz jak, zbuduj sobie bieżącą
wersję z CVS-u. Najnowsze jest 0.12rc1. Niestety, nie mam athlona, bo bym
ci podesłał. Mam P4, ale obawiam się, że to może nie zadziałać.
> 3. Kompilacja ndiswrapper ze źródeł. Ściągnąłem najnowsze źródła
> ndiswrapper-a, rozpakowałem i przystąpiłem do instalacji.
> Pierwsza niesopdzianka: nie ma configure. Ok, to nic, bez tego też się
> da. Piszę make. Od razu wywaliło kilka błędów, zanim cokolwiek zaczęło
> się kompilować (na początku brakowało mu nagłówków kernela, potem źródeł
> kernela, a jak już je doinstalowałem to okazało się że brakuje mu pliku
> .config (zapewne tego tworzonego przy kompilacji jadra). Właściwie to
Ten plik utworzysz tak: cd /usr/src/linux; cp config-up .config
To dla maszyny jednoprocesorowej, analogicznie cp config-smp .config dla
wieloprocesorowej. Oczywiście z root-a. To powinno wystarczyć.
[...]
> Wie ktoś co jest potrzebne do skompilowania ndiswrapper (oprócz tego co
> jest na MINI-ISO)?
Tego niestety nie wiem. Ale wydaje mi się, że niewiele więcej, jeśli
cokolwiek. Jeśli ci nie pójdzie po powyższych podpowiedziach, podeślij
proszę to, co ci kompilator wypisuje przy budowaniu sterownika.
--
Łukasz Maśko ICQ: 146553537 _o)
Lukasz.Masko(at)ipipan.waw.pl GG: 2441498 /\\
Registered Linux User #61028 _\_V
Więcej informacji o liście dyskusyjnej pld-users-pl